There are a vast number of United Nations stamps issued for use at the United Nations offices in New York, Geneva and now Vienna. Some of the earlier issues have some value, consult a postage stamp catalog to identify and find the catalog values for them.
The United States has issued over the years 47 different stamps showing Abraham Lincoln. A complete list of them can be seen on page 77A of the 2009 Scott Specialized Catalogue of United States Stamps & Covers. In addition, several foreign nations have issued stamps with pictures of Lincoln.

By law, United States postage stamps can honor only those individuals that have died or fictional characters. However, other nations can and do use living persons on their stamps. For example, British stamps often feature portraits of the current monarch and many stamps from Vatican City show the current Pope.
